'Lucid' dreamers are people who claim they are aware that they are dreaming and can deliberately control their actions in dreams. When people dream that they are performing a particular action, a portion of the brain involved in the planning and execution of movement lights up with activity. 

This learned skill presents an opportunity for researchers who are studying the neural underpinnings of our dreams and their findings in Current Biology, made by scanning the brains of lucid dreamers while they slept, give us a glimpse into non-waking consciousness and perhaps create a waypoint toward true "dream reading." 

Higher levels of testosterone have been associated with reduced lean muscle mass loss in older men, especially in those who were losing weight. In thoese men, higher testosterone levels were also associated with less loss of lower body strength.

Loss of muscle mass and strength contribute to frailty and are associated with falls, mobility limitations and fractures. Men also lose more muscle mass and strength than women as they age, suggesting that sex steroids, and testosterone in particular, may contribute to body composition and physical function changes.

Experiments have recently supported a longstanding hypothesis that explains how males can survive with only one copy of the X chromosome, a hotly debated topic in science.

Women have two X chromosomes, while men have one X and one Y. The lack of a 'back up' copy of the X chromosome in males contributes to many disorders that have long been observed to occur more often in males, such as hemophilia, Duchene muscular dystrophy and certain types of color blindness. Having only one copy of X and two copies of every other chromosome also creates a more fundamental problem; with any other chromosome, the gene number imbalance resulting from having only one copy would be lethal.

How can males survive with only one X?

In November 2010, the distant dwarf planet Eris passed in front of a faint background star, an event called an occultation. Occultations provide the most accurate, and often the only, way to measure the shape and size of a distant Solar System body like Eris.

Eris was identified as a large object in the outer Solar System in 2005. Its discovery was one of the factors that led to the creation of a new class of objects called dwarf planets by the IAU and the demotion of Pluto from planet to dwarf planet in 2006. Eris is currently three times further from the Sun than Pluto.

Astronomers are reporting that organic compounds of unexpected complexity exist throughout the Universe - which mean they can be made naturally by stars.

Researchers write in Nature that an organic substance commonly found throughout the Universe contains a mixture of aromatic (ring-like) and aliphatic (chain-like) components, compounds so complex that their chemical structures resemble those of coal and petroleum. 

Since coal and oil are remnants of ancient life, this type of organic matter was thought to arise only from living organisms but this new discovery suggests that complex organic compounds can be synthesized in space - even when no life forms are present.

Scientists have discovered more about the intricacies of Natural Killer cells, a unique type of white blood cell important in early immune responses to tumors and viruses.  

Unlike most cells of the immune system that are activated by molecules found on the pathogen or tumor, Natural Killer cells are shut down by a group of proteins found on healthy cells. These de-activating proteins, known as Human Leukocyte Antigens or HLA molecules are absent in many tumors and cells infected with viruses, leaving them open to attack by the Natural Killer cells. 

Natural Killer cells recognize the HLA molecules using an inbuilt surveillance system called "Killer cell immunoglobulin-like receptors" (KIR).
